Dome Tents
While several variables enter into picking the appropriate outdoor tents for an offered journey, dome outdoors tents are usually favored as a result of their livability and toughness. They are commonly light-weight, with polyester or nylon textile blends and a lot of mesh. They additionally often tend to have light weight aluminum camping tent poles, which are lighter and stronger than other types of tent poles.
Another advantage of dome outdoors tents is their adaptability. They can be made use of in a selection of setups, consisting of occasions and glamping. They are likewise less sensitive to the wind compared to tunnel tents.
The Kelty Wireless is a fantastic instance of a top quality dome outdoor tents that supplies both livability and longevity. This six-person outdoor tents includes 2 doors and vestibules (both the Coleman Skydome and Sundome just have one) in addition to a full-coverage rain fly, which is useful in wet conditions. However, it uses fiberglass outdoor tents posts, which aren't as strong as aluminum options. This isn't a deal-breaker for many, however it is worth keeping in mind.
Cabin Tents
Ground tents have a lot to supply the overland camper. They're usually considerably less costly than RTTs and they permit a little additional space to rest comfortably on a cot. Several additionally include a big exterior awning which can be surveyed to develop an outside "living space" that is protected from the sunlight throughout the day.
They generally have a high peak elevation which enables taller campers to stand inside the camping tent and they usually have a huge quantity of headroom throughout the interior. They can also be fitted with a different groundsheet guard or camping tent footprint which is laid under the external material to avoid moisture from soaking through to the internal camping tent.
Many cabin outdoors tents have posts which are either colour-coded or linked together to make it simple to identify which ones attach where and they often tend to make use of a rather considerable number of man ropes, which need to be placed and tensioned exactly in order to pitch the tent appropriately. They can be rather heavy to transport, which might need the use of a car-top copyright or a roof covering rack to carry them.

Trailer Tents
Some trailer outdoors tents use the trailer body itself to develop part of the resting area. These 'stroller hood' kind trailer tents are extremely quick to pitch and very cosy in cool and wet climate. They are typically additionally extremely tiny to enable them to suit the back of a small cars and truck - very beneficial if you have restricted home storage space for such an outdoor camping unit. Many designs of this kind consist of a vestibule which is a floorless protected section outside the primary door and utilized for saving gear.
Other trailer outdoors tents are a little bit like folding campers and caravans, with an inner camping tent being in a frame on top of the trailer body. Some of these models can have awnings to boost living room. This sort of trailer outdoor tents is ideal suited to those who wish to invest the shortest time possible pitching up and putting down. Makers supply a large range of optional bonus, consisting of kitchen units and beds/couchettes, to improve the convenience degree of this type of tent.
